Why Hire a Professional Wedding DJ?
A experienced wedding DJ offers many advantages to your celebration:
- Knowledge in gauging the crowd
- High-quality sound equipment
- Extensive music selection
- Ability to seamlessly transition between songs
- Proficiency in coordinating the event flow
Important Considerations When Hiring a Wedding DJ
1. Experience
Seek out a DJ with considerable experience in weddings. Ask about their history and the number of weddings they've DJed.
2. Music Selection
Ensure that the DJ offers a diverse variety of music types to cater to all tastes. Talk about your favorite genres and crucial songs.
3. Sound System
Discuss the quality of equipment the DJ uses. High-quality equipment guarantees clear sound quality throughout your event.
4. Personality
Choose a DJ whose personality aligns with your event vibe. They should be courteous, approachable, and able to interact with your guests appropriately.
5. Pricing
Compare pricing from multiple DJs, but remember that the lowest price isn't always offer the best quality. Find a balance between price and experience.
Questions to Ask When Interviewing Potential Wedding DJs
- How long have you been DJing?
- Do you have expertise with our reception location?
- What packages do you offer?
- Can you share testimonials from previous clients?
- How do you handle song requests from guests?
- Do you provide master of ceremonies services?
- What's your backup plan if equipment fails?
Advice for Getting the Most Out of Your Wedding DJ
To guarantee your wedding celebration goes smoothly, follow these recommendations:
- Discuss your vision clearly
- Develop a list of must-play songs
- Go over any music you don't want played
- Arrange a in-person meeting before the big day
- Tell the DJ about any special dances
- Have confidence in their judgment
